As a Regional Asset Management Specialist, you will play a crucial role in the highway operations sector. Key duties include collecting road data, using the Asset/Maintenance Management System, and implementing pavement prediction technology for effective project planning. Your expertise in highway maintenance and financial management will guide budget adherence and program execution.
Key Responsibilities:
• Develop and administer regional maintenance programs
• Collect and verify road data for project planning
• Utilize maintenance management software for operations
• Prepare reports and correspondence for stakeholders
• Train and mentor team members in best practices
Requirements:
• Extensive highway maintenance or road construction experience
• Strong knowledge of maintenance equipment and materials
• Proficiency in Microsoft Office tools
• Effective communication skills for diverse audiences
• Valid Manitoba Class 5 driver's license required
